Indie-Folk Singer-Songwriter Marem Ladson Drops Her "Círculos" Video

 
 

After releasing her bilingual EP “Azul” last month, indie-folk singer-songwriter Marem Ladson has returned to share the video for “Círculos.” Azul received praise from outlets like NPR, which wrote, “her sumptuous hooks and sweetly lilting vocals seem to form a language unto themselves.” Catch Marem performing songs from the new EP on Facebook Live for Earmilk on Wednesday, April 15 at 3pm ET. “Círculos” tackles the concept of fate and destiny, and the uncertainty that everything we do is predetermined, leading us to ask: What if everything was already written from the beginning? “This is a universal question that many writers and philosophers have discussed throughout history, and it’s something that was on my mind when I wrote the song. If everything is part of a plan and there’s a bigger force that already knows what’s going to happen, then our lives are already determined,” Marem explains.

The video for “Círculos” was filmed in Andalusia, Spain and continues the narrative that began with from Marem’s previous music video, “No Sentir Nada.” The video follows Marem on a new journey of self-discovery as she wanders through the Andalusian caves and goldmines, trying to find her own path and singing, all this time I’ve been deluded, couldn’t do anything, walking in circles.
